"""Serverless-compatible FastAPI application for Vercel deployment."""

import os
import sys
from pathlib import Path

# Add src to path for imports
src_path = Path(__file__).parent.parent / "src"
sys.path.insert(0, str(src_path))

from contextlib import asynccontextmanager
from datetime import datetime
from typing import Optional
from fastapi import FastAPI, Depends, HTTPException, Query
from fastapi.middleware.cors import CORSMiddleware
from sqlalchemy.orm import Session

# Import components - delay heavy imports until needed to avoid initialization issues
def get_database_components():
    from database import get_db, engine, Base
    return get_db, engine, Base

def get_models():
    from models.todo import Todo
    from models.user import User
    return Todo, User

def get_schemas():
    from schemas.todo import TodoCreate, TodoUpdate, TodoResponse, TodoListResponse
    return TodoCreate, TodoUpdate, TodoResponse, TodoListResponse

def get_services():
    from services.todo_service import TodoService
    return TodoService

def get_routers():
    from api.routes.auth import router as auth_router
    from api.chat_router import router as chat_router
    from api.task_router import router as task_router
    return auth_router, chat_router, task_router

def get_middlewares():
    from middleware.auth import get_current_user
    return get_current_user


app = FastAPI(
    title="Todo API",
    description="REST API for managing todo items with extended features",
    version="2.0.0"
)

# Configure CORS for production - allow your frontend domain
# For production, replace with your actual frontend URL
frontend_url = os.getenv("FRONTEND_URL", "https://localhost:3000")
allow_origins = [frontend_url]

# Add localhost origins for development if in development mode
environment = os.getenv("ENVIRONMENT", "development")
if environment.lower() != "production":
    allow_origins.extend([
        "http://localhost:3000",
        "http://localhost:3001",
        "http://localhost:3002",
        "http://localhost:3006",
        "http://localhost:3007"
    ])

app.add_middleware(
    CORSMiddleware,
    allow_origins=allow_origins,
    allow_credentials=True,
    allow_methods=["*"],
    allow_headers=["*"],
)

# Include routers
auth_router, chat_router, task_router = get_routers()
app.include_router(auth_router, prefix="/api/v1")
app.include_router(chat_router)
app.include_router(task_router, prefix="/api/v1")


def _calculate_overdue(todo, datetime_module=datetime):
    """Calculate if a todo is overdue."""
    if todo.due_date is None or todo.completed:
        return False
    return todo.due_date < datetime_module.utcnow()


def _todo_to_response(todo):
    """Convert Todo model to TodoResponse schema."""
    TodoResponse = get_schemas()[2]  # Get TodoResponse from schemas
    response_data = {
        "id": todo.id,
        "user_id": todo.user_id,
        "title": todo.title,
        "description": todo.description,
        "completed": todo.completed,
        "priority": todo.priority,
        "tags": todo.tags,
        "due_date": todo.due_date,
        "recurrence": todo.recurrence,
        "created_at": todo.created_at,
        "updated_at": todo.updated_at,
        "overdue": _calculate_overdue(todo)
    }
    return TodoResponse(**response_data)


@app.get("/api/v1/todos", response_model=None)  # Will set response_model dynamically
def get_todos(

    db: Session = Depends(lambda: get_database_components()[0]()),

    current_user: object = Depends(lambda: get_middlewares()[0]()),

    search: Optional[str] = Query(None, description="Search in title and description"),

    status: Optional[str] = Query(None, pattern="^(completed|pending)$", description="Filter by status"),

    priority: Optional[str] = Query(None, pattern="^(low|medium|high)$", description="Filter by priority"),

    due_before: Optional[datetime] = Query(None, description="Filter todos due before this date"),

    due_after: Optional[datetime] = Query(None, description="Filter todos due after this date"),

    tag: Optional[str] = Query(None, description="Filter by specific tag"),

    sort_by: Optional[str] = Query("created_at", pattern="^(created_at|due_date|priority|title)$", description="Sort field"),

    sort_order: Optional[str] = Query("desc", pattern="^(asc|desc)$", description="Sort order"),

):
    """Get all todos with optional search, filtering, and sorting."""
    TodoListResponse = get_schemas()[3]  # Get TodoListResponse from schemas
    app.router.routes[-1].response_model = TodoListResponse  # Set response model dynamically

    TodoService = get_services()[0]  # Get TodoService from services
    service = TodoService(db, user_id=current_user.id)
    todos = service.get_all(
        search=search,
        status=status,
        priority=priority,
        due_before=due_before,
        due_after=due_after,
        tag=tag,
        sort_by=sort_by,
        sort_order=sort_order
    )

    # Convert to response schema with overdue calculation
    todos_response = [_todo_to_response(todo) for todo in todos]

    return {
        "todos": todos_response,
        "count": len(todos_response),
        "has_more": False  # Pagination not implemented yet
    }


@app.post("/api/v1/todos", response_model=None, status_code=201)
def create_todo(

    todo_data: object,  # Will be validated dynamically

    db: Session = Depends(lambda: get_database_components()[0]()),

    current_user: object = Depends(lambda: get_middlewares()[0]())

):
    """Create a new todo with optional extended fields."""
    TodoResponse = get_schemas()[2]  # Get TodoResponse from schemas
    app.router.routes[-1].response_model = TodoResponse  # Set response model dynamically

    try:
        TodoService = get_services()[0]  # Get TodoService from services
        service = TodoService(db, user_id=current_user.id)
        todo = service.create(todo_data)
        return _todo_to_response(todo)
    except ValueError as e:
        raise HTTPException(status_code=400, detail=str(e))


@app.get("/api/v1/todos/{todo_id}", response_model=None)
def get_todo(

    todo_id: int,

    db: Session = Depends(lambda: get_database_components()[0]()),

    current_user: object = Depends(lambda: get_middlewares()[0]())

):
    """Get a single todo by ID."""
    TodoResponse = get_schemas()[2]  # Get TodoResponse from schemas
    app.router.routes[-1].response_model = TodoResponse  # Set response model dynamically

    TodoService = get_services()[0]  # Get TodoService from services
    service = TodoService(db, user_id=current_user.id)
    todo = service.get_by_id(todo_id)
    if not todo:
        raise HTTPException(status_code=404, detail="Todo not found")
    return _todo_to_response(todo)


@app.put("/api/v1/todos/{todo_id}", response_model=None)
def update_todo(

    todo_id: int,

    todo_data: object,  # Will be validated dynamically

    db: Session = Depends(lambda: get_database_components()[0]()),

    current_user: object = Depends(lambda: get_middlewares()[0]())

):
    """Update a todo with optional extended fields."""
    TodoResponse = get_schemas()[2]  # Get TodoResponse from schemas
    app.router.routes[-1].response_model = TodoResponse  # Set response model dynamically

    try:
        TodoService = get_services()[0]  # Get TodoService from services
        service = TodoService(db, user_id=current_user.id)
        todo = service.update(todo_id, todo_data)
        if not todo:
            raise HTTPException(status_code=404, detail="Todo not found")
        return _todo_to_response(todo)
    except ValueError as e:
        raise HTTPException(status_code=400, detail=str(e))


@app.delete("/api/v1/todos/{todo_id}")
def delete_todo(

    todo_id: int,

    db: Session = Depends(lambda: get_database_components()[0]()),

    current_user: object = Depends(lambda: get_middlewares()[0]())

):
    """Delete a todo."""
    TodoService = get_services()[0]  # Get TodoService from services
    service = TodoService(db, user_id=current_user.id)
    if not service.delete(todo_id):
        raise HTTPException(status_code=404, detail="Todo not found")
    return {"message": "Todo deleted successfully"}


@app.patch("/api/v1/todos/{todo_id}/complete")
def mark_todo_complete(

    todo_id: int,

    db: Session = Depends(lambda: get_database_components()[0]()),

    current_user: object = Depends(lambda: get_middlewares()[0]())

):
    """

    Mark a todo as complete.

    If the todo has a recurrence pattern, automatically creates the next instance.

    Returns both the completed task and the next task (if applicable).

    """
    TodoService = get_services()[0]  # Get TodoService from services
    service = TodoService(db, user_id=current_user.id)
    result = service.mark_complete(todo_id)
    if result is None:
        raise HTTPException(status_code=404, detail="Todo not found")

    Todo, _ = get_models()  # Get Todo model
    TodoResponse = get_schemas()[2]  # Get TodoResponse from schemas

    completed_task, next_task = result

    response = {
        "completed_task": _todo_to_response(completed_task)
    }

    if next_task:
        response["next_task"] = _todo_to_response(next_task)

    return response


@app.get("/api/v1/todos/due-soon")
def get_todos_due_soon(

    hours: int = Query(1, ge=1, le=24, description="Number of hours to look ahead"),

    db: Session = Depends(lambda: get_database_components()[0]()),

    current_user: object = Depends(lambda: get_middlewares()[0]())

):
    """Get todos due within the specified hours for reminder notifications."""
    TodoService = get_services()[0]  # Get TodoService from services
    service = TodoService(db, user_id=current_user.id)
    todos = service.get_todos_due_soon(hours=hours)
    todos_response = [_todo_to_response(todo) for todo in todos]
    return {"todos": todos_response, "count": len(todos_response)}


@app.get("/")
def root():
    """Root endpoint for health check."""
    return {"message": "Todo API is running", "status": "healthy"}


@app.get("/health")
def health_check():
    """Health check endpoint."""
    return {"status": "healthy", "timestamp": datetime.now()}
